Why These Are the Top Dodge Repair Auto Repair Shops in Jupiter

** The Dodge repair market in Jupiter is bifurcated. On one end, you have the authorized dealership (Braman) which provides factory-certified service, warranty work, and OEM part assurance, typically at a premium cost. On the other end, the independent specialist market is niche but robust, dominated by a few highly specialized shops like HEMI Hideout and regional leaders like Palm Beach Dyno. **Average Quality:** The quality for high-performance Dodge repair is generally high, given the affluent local market and the complex nature of the vehicles. Shops that succeed have invested in specialized tools, training, and diagnostic software. **Competition Level:** While there are many general auto repair shops, true specialists in HEMI, SRT, and Hellcat platforms face little direct competition from generalists. The real competition is between the top-tier independents and the dealership, with customers choosing based on their priority: cutting-edge performance tuning (independents) vs. factory warranty and certification (dealership). **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is at a premium tier. Dealership labor rates are typically the highest, often exceeding $175/hour. Specialized independent shops are also premium, with rates ranging from $140-$160/hour, but they often provide more personalized service and performance-focused expertise that the dealership's general service department may not match. A simple oil change on a Hellcat can be $150+, while specialized work like a supercharger service or custom dyno tune can run into the thousands.

What are the most common Dodge repair issues seen in Jupiter, Florida, due to the local climate?

The coastal humidity and salt air in Jupiter can accelerate corrosion of brake lines, exhaust components, and electrical connections. Additionally, frequent use of air conditioning in the heat places extra strain on the compressor and related systems in Dodge vehicles, making these common repair points.

What local Jupiter factors should I consider when scheduling Dodge maintenance?

Schedule A/C system checks before the intense summer heat and consider more frequent undercarriage inspections due to salt air exposure. Also, plan around Jupiter's seasonal influx of residents, as reputable shops can get busier, leading to longer wait times for appointments.
